Case summary

A retired resident of Slantsy (the Leningrad region), he worked at a sewage treatment plant. Before that, according to his wife, he designed and created medical equipment, worked in aviation, fulfilled orders for the police, taught programming to children, and participated in publishing books on military and patriotic topics.

On August 28, 2024, he was detained at work for public justification of terrorism: according to his wife, the reason was comments in a Telegram channel dedicated to the Ukrainian Azov battalion. Later it became known that one of the comments looked like "Congratulations from Ingria". The court elected for him a measure of restraint in the form of a prohibition of certain actions. On December 23, 2024, Titov was fined 15,000 rubles under the administrative article on discrediting the army (Article 20.3.3 of the Code of Administrative Offences) because of a comment in Ukrainian language in which the Russian military was allegedly called rubbish.

On September 3, 2025, the Investigative Committee reported the transfer of his case to court. On November 6, during the hearing, the judge sent Titov to custody because he had missed the previous session. According to his wife, Titov had an asthma attack and the judge was provided with medical documents. The prosecutor suggested placing the defendant under house arrest.

On December 8, 2025, Titov was sentenced to five and a half years in a general regime colony.
